Notes: Your stay at “Under Canvas” in Livingston will be truly unique as you will be staying in a safari-inspired tented camp. Each tented camp has a private bath that features eco-conscious amenities such pull-chain showers with hot water, sinks that automatically shut off, and low-flow flush toilets. To allow guests to disconnect and feel truly immersed in nature, and to minimize the use of precious resources, there is not electricity nor outlets in the tents. However, there are battery-powered fans and lanterns with USB plugs so you can charge at least two cell phones. Temperatures vary greatly in this region and each tent is equipped with a wood-burning stove for additional heat (instructions of use will be provided upon arrival and assistance is available if needed.)

Using the original entrance to Yellowstone, the iconic Roosevelt Arch greets your entry to America’s First National Park. Visit Mammoth Hot Springs in the northern part of the park, where heat, water, limestone, and rock fractures have created a unique terrace feature. Enjoy lunch with a ranger to learn about the famous hot springs and park’s thermal features. Continue to the Yellowstone Tribal Heritage Center, where local artists display and demonstrate nature photography, beadwork, storytelling, watercolor painting and more. Explore on your own with the remainder of the day at leisure in the park

Journey on the John D. Rockefeller Jr. Memorial Parkway for stunning views of the Grand Teton Mountains, Jackson Lake, Jenny Lake, and the Chapel of Transfiguration en route to Jackson. Marvel at the spectacular Wyoming scenery on a Teton Village tram ride. Tonight, celebrate your adventure with a festive farewell dinner
